Time keeping & time limit
The time keeping is done with the MIKA TAG. The MIKA TAG consists of the start number on which a transponder is attached. The timing is done as usual by running over the mats at the start and finish.
Since the MIKA TAG is a "disposable transponder", there is no need to return the start number.
The time limit is 3 hours.

Relay batons
Every team needs a baton to pass on to the next runner.
The transitions are one of the highlights of the race. The more original the batons are, the easier they are for the teams to identify to ensure a quick transition. There are no limits to creativity.
Of course, if needed, you can borrow a "normal" baton on site.
